Lateral Flow Assays Market Summary
The global lateral flow assays (LFA) market size was estimated at approximately USD 10.17 billion in 2025 and is projected to reach USD 17.44 billion by 2033, growing at a CAGR of 7.41% from 2026 to 2033, driven by the increasing demand for rapid and cost-effective diagnostic solutions, particularly in Point-of-Care (POC) and home-testing applications. Technological advancements now allow for improved performance and use of lateral flow assays, including advances in sensitivity, specificity, multiplexing, and digital applications via smartphone apps and cloud-connected devices. The latter advances have meant that lateral flow devices may be used in areas outside infectious disease detection, including pregnancy testing, heart disease monitoring, veterinary diagnostics, environmental testing, and food safety. As part of the advances above, Abingdon Health plc (UK) has established itself as a key player in the lateral flow market. In May 2024, Abingdon Health plc launched Boots' own-brand saliva-based pregnancy self-test to the UK and online via Salignostics and Crest Medical. This product represents a technological shift from traditional urine-based pregnancy tests to non-invasive saliva testing, thus providing greater convenience and accessibility for the user. In addition to launching the product, the significant advancement in product innovation provided an opportunity to further strengthen Abingdon Health's strategic partnership with Boots as the first company to adapt a saliva pregnancy self-test into Boots' own-brand range. These advances demonstrate how biotechnology innovation, consumer health, and strategic partnerships continue to influence the direction of the global lateral flow assays industry.
